Drew Basile Talks Survivor 50 Ep 12 A double Tribal shakes things up in Survivor 50 as Rob Cesternino hosts this thought-provoking recap with special guest and Survivor expert Drew Basile. Season 50’s late game brings old-school energy, with two back-to-back Tribal Councils, sharper editing, and a more classic Survivor feel that leaves both Rob and Drew questioning every strategic move. Rob and Drew hit the ground running, comparing Survivor’s “new era” twists with pop culture analogies—what happens when nostalgia and new players collide? The conversation quickly turns to pivotal gameplay in the final seven and six, where dehydration and exhaustion drive risky moves, alliances are tested, and legends like Cirie face the ultimate endgame dilemma. Drew breaks down the emergence of new big-move players like Rick Devens and questions whether the era of careful, “voting block” gameplay is coming to an end. Survivor 50 Recap dives into: – How two full Tribal Councils in one episode shift pacing and strategy – Why Rick Devens’ bold moves could inspire future players to go “for the glory” – The downfall of Cirie: can the best social player ever make Final Three, or is she too dangerous to keep around? – Tribal council music cues, editing choices, and the return of classic Survivor nostalgia – The shifting reputation of challenge beasts like Jonathan and Joe, and whether physical threats can win in the new era – Drew’s behind-the-scenes insights into production preferences for gameplay and who Survivor wants as “representative” winners As the endgame approaches, Rob and Drew openly debate whether Rizo’s flashy idol antics help or hurt, who stands to benefit from final four fire-making, and if anyone can “reverse the curse” in the finale.
